This report proffers the thorough economics of mesitylene production by distillation process. The production process is initiated by treating acetone with sulfuric acid. In this reaction, sulfuric acid serves as a dehydrating agent and leads to the distillation of acetone, resulting in the production of mesitylene or 1,3,5-trimethylbenzene as the final product.
Mesitylene is an aromatic hydrocarbon variety synthesized by using acetone and sulfuric acid as its major feedstocks. The procurement of mesitylene and its feedstocks is mainly dependent upon factors such as the cost of preparation, variations in its market prices, stability in its supply chain, availability of its raw materials (including propylene, benzene, sulfur, and oxygen for sulfuric acid and acetone production), and logistics, etc. Additionally, factors such as its demand in its downstream industries (including pharmaceutical and chemical industries), trading and transportation activities, economic and governmental policies also influence its procurement.
